Jasper teen one of three killed in Lufkin auto crash

Lufkin Police have announced that a jasper teenager has been arrested following a triple-fatality crash there which left another Jasper teen and two others dead, and three injured. It occurred at about midnight Saturday morning on South First Street in front of the Ralph & Kacoos Restaurant. Police say 17-year-old Tyler Lewis is charged with three counts of Intoxication Manslaughter, and additional charges are pending. According to Lufkin Police, Lewis was driving a small car southbound on South First Street when he made a sudden lane change and was rear-ended by another vehicle. The report said Lewis' car then spun into the median and came to an abrupt stop. According to the report, Lewis was not injured, but three passengers in the vehicle he was driving were pronounced dead at the scene and three other passengers were injured. Police said the driver of the other vehicle involved was not injured. The dead have been identified as:

Xavier Grimble, zo, of jasper

Antwonique Robertson, 18, of Carthage

Anastasia Gray, 19, of Carthage

The injured have been identified as:

Omorion Lewis, 17, of Jasper - Treated and released from a Lufkin hospital

Radaysha Jackson, 18, of Kirbyville - Flown to a Tyler hospital

Relly Brown, 19, of Carthage - Flown to a Tyler hospital
